Kevin Campbell's hat‑trick fuels Nottingham Forest's 1996 win

🇬🇧 1 uur geleden
On 17 August 1996, Kevin Campbell netted a hat‑trick as Nottingham Forest thrashed Coventry City 3‑0 at the City Ground, a result that sparked early optimism before the campaign yielded only six Premier League victories and ended with the club at the bottom of the table. Dave attended the Forest‑versus‑Coventry clash at the old Highfield Road stadium on his 13th birthday, watching the Reds win 3‑0 on a beautiful sunny day. It was the first of many road trips to come. Arthur remembers the Southend away fixture in 1993, the first away match of a new season that saw Forest already relegated. A shortage of hotel rooms forced supporters to sleep in their cars, prompting police to draft in reinforcements. The sold‑out game even had Teddy Sheringham sitting with Forest fans. Gary recalls losing at Coventry 2‑1 on the opening day of the 2021‑22 season, with the winning goal arriving in the 96th minute. Forest later turned the tide by winning the Championship play‑off final. Jack recalls Everton away on 20 August 1977, when pundits wrote the team off before the season began. Bob Wilson dismissed the side as a "flash in the pan". Forest finished as champions and later secured the European Cup on two occasions.
